NextGen FREE rider training in Dorset

DocBike is delighted to offer our no-cost rider training course to motorcyclists aged 16-35, who have a current CBT, but who have not yet obtained their full motorcycle licence and who have a motorcycle to bring with them which they are legally allowed to ride on public roads. The bike must be roadworthy, have a current MOT and be taxed and insured.

IAM RoadSmart and Phoenix Training will supervise the rider skills section and John Milbank, from Bennetts BikeSocial, will run the bike security section.
